 SM and NLO Multi-leg, jets and Higgs 

  Session I: 30 May-8 June 2011

New approaches  (unitarity technqiues, string inspired, bootstrap, ...),   Improvements on standard techniques (semi-numerical approach, automatization, ..) NNLO, Higgs observables, jets
This group will address the issue of the theoretical predictions for multileg processes, in particular beyond leading order, and the possibility of implementing these calculations in Monte Carlos. This working group aims at a cross breeding between novel approaches (twistors, unitarity cuts,...) and improvements in standard techniques. The precision NLO and in some instances NNLO predictions extend also to Higgs observables.  New development in the physics of jets will also covered.
